Volkswagen Crafter 2006 Training Manual: What You’ll Find Inside
The manual is organized into seven system chapters plus a service section. Body structure and occupant protection start on page 12 and 20. Engines (the 2.5L TDI) begin on page 22. Transmission, page 26 – includes the Shiftmatic 0B81 automated manual gearbox. Running gear from page 32, electrical system on page 44, heating and AC on page 50. The service section (page 58) gives maintenance intervals and quick reference data. Every chapter is built around the real-world things a technician needs: system descriptions, component locations, and basic diagnostic logic.
7 Systems Covered in 60 Pages
This training manual covers seven core vehicle systems: body, occupant protection (airbags, belts), engines (2.5L TDI), transmission (manual and Shiftmatic), running gear (suspension, brakes, steering), electrical system (wiring overview, CAN bus basics), and HVAC. The “Servicio” chapter at the end ties it all together with service schedules and inspection points. Does This Manual Cover the Fuel System?
Not as a separate chapter. The engine section covers the 2.5L TDI’s basic layout, injection timing, and common rail overview, but it’s a training summary – not a pump overhaul guide.
